NON
Showing 1297–1305 of 3619 results
-

GIA 2357354994
£5,232.47 Add to cart -

GIA 2357363177
£680.40 Add to cart -

GIA 2357366856
£4,270.00 Add to cart -

GIA 2357369843
£2,025.40 Add to cart -

GIA 2357370058
£3,080.00 Add to cart -

GIA 2357371661
£1,652.00 Add to cart -

GIA 2357371738
£744.80 Add to cart -

GIA 2357373222
£2,016.00 Add to cart -

GIA 2357373881
£1,183.20 Add to cart